Srinagar: Lieutenant Governor Manoj Sinha has called for the establishment of Artificial Intelligence (AI) Labs in all universities across Jammu and Kashmir to promote cutting-edge research and innovation.
While addressing a seminar on National Science Day at the University of Kashmir, Sinha as per news agency JKNS paid rich tributes to renowned scientist Sir CV Raman and emphasized the need to advance science and technology, encourage knowledge exchange, and foster creativity for a sustainable future.
He said the AI Lab will function as a separate entity within the Science & Technology Department, facilitating multidisciplinary collaboration among industry, researchers, educators, and technologists.
Highlighting the transformative impact of AI, Sinha said, “We cannot imagine a future without AI. It will profoundly influence every aspect of our lives. That’s why it is critical to equip our youth with AI knowledge, reskill and upskill the workforce to stay ahead of AI trends, and enhance J&K’s competitiveness.”
Sinha added that AI Labs in universities will work directly with local industries to integrate AI-driven discoveries into businesses. The research will also focus on analyzing AI’s current use and exploring ways to enhance its adoption to boost productivity and profitability.—(JKNS)
